Why Cleaning Solar Panels Matters
Solar panels rely on sunlight to generate electricity. Any obstruction—be it dust, leaves, or pollution—can block sunlight and decrease energy production. Studies have shown that dirty solar panels can lose between 15% to 30% of their efficiency. In places with heavy dust, sand, or bird activity, this loss can be even greater.
Using a regular Solar Panel Cleaning System is crucial, but manual cleaning has its downsides. It often requires significant labor, water usage, and can be difficult in remote or elevated installations. These issues have led to the growing demand for a smarter, automated solution.
What is an Automatic Solar Panel Cleaning System?
An Automatic Solar Panel Cleaning System is a technologically advanced setup designed to clean solar panels without human involvement. These systems are typically installed along with the solar panels and can be programmed to clean at regular intervals—daily, weekly, or as needed.
Types of automated systems include:
- Rotating brush systems: Gently sweep the panels without causing scratches.
- Robotic cleaners: Move across the surface using sensors and smart navigation.
- Air jet or blower systems: Use pressurized air to remove dust.
- Water-efficient spray systems: Use minimal water and operate automatically.
Some advanced systems even integrate sensors and IoT technology to detect dirt levels and activate cleaning only when necessary, optimizing both energy output and resource usage.
Benefits of Using a Modern Solar Panel Cleaning System
Whether manual or automatic, a good Solar Panel Cleaning System brings several benefits:
- Increased energy output: Clean panels can absorb more sunlight.
- Reduced maintenance cost: Less frequent need for manual labor.
- Time savings: Automated systems work without user input.
- Environmental friendliness: Some systems use little to no water.
- Improved safety: Reduces the need for technicians to climb on rooftops or access difficult locations.
